  /**
  * <pre>
  * The rule for use of CRL corresponding to this CA certificate during client authentication. If crlCheck is set to Mandatory, the system will deny all SSL clients if the CRL is missing, expired - NextUpdate date is in the past, or is incomplete with remote CRL refresh enabled. If crlCheck is set to optional, the system will allow SSL clients in the above error cases.However, in any case if the client certificate is revoked in the CRL, the SSL client will be denied access.<br> Default value: CRLCHECK_OPTIONAL<br> Possible values = Mandatory, Optional
  * </pre>
  */
  public void set_crlcheck(String crlcheck) throws Exception{
    this.crlcheck = crlcheck;
  }

  /**
  * <pre>
  * The rule for use of CRL corresponding to this CA certificate during client authentication. If crlCheck is set to Mandatory, the system will deny all SSL clients if the CRL is missing, expired - NextUpdate date is in the past, or is incomplete with remote CRL refresh enabled. If crlCheck is set to optional, the system will allow SSL clients in the above error cases.However, in any case if the client certificate is revoked in the CRL, the SSL client will be denied access.<br> Default value: CRLCHECK_OPTIONAL<br> Possible values = Mandatory, Optional
  * </pre>
  */
  public String get_crlcheck() throws Exception {
    return this.crlcheck;
  }
